San Antonio Independent School District
Located deep in the heart of the Alamo City for more than 100 years, SAISD is Bexar County’s third-largest school district, serving more than 50,000 students.

IDEA Public Schools
IDEA Public Schools believes that each and every child can go to college. Since 2001, IDEA Public Schools has grown from a small school with 150 students to the fastest-growing network of tuition-free, Pre-K-12 public charter schools in the United States.
George Gervin Academy
Established in 1995, George Gervin Academy is a free public charter school that serves students in pre-kindergarten through twelfth grade. Students at George Gervin Academy meet or exceed state target scores for student achievement, student progress, closing performance gaps, and postsecondary readiness. We are proud to have earned the 2013 accountability rating of “Met Standard,” the highest rating possible.

KIPP San Antonio
KIPP San Antonio is part of the national KIPP network of free, open-enrollment, college-preparatory public schools dedicated to preparing students in underserved communities for success in college and life.
